HOTEL RESTAURANT
LES VIGNES BLANCHES
BEAUCAIRE FRANCE
LEAD INTERIOR DESIGNER
CLIENT : A+ ARCHITECTURE

Located in the heart of Beaucaire, the "Les Vignes Blanches" project involved the renovation and redefinition of a hotel space with strong regional identity. The aim was to breathe new life into the interiors while preserving the local character and enhancing the guest experience.
As lead interior designer on the project, I was responsible for the overall concept design, material selection, and furniture layout. I developed moodboards, color palettes, and design guidelines that paid homage to the Provençal atmosphere while bringing a contemporary and welcoming touch.
My role also involved coordinating with suppliers, artisans, and the architectural team to ensure the design vision was executed with precision and coherence. Special attention was given to the reception areas, the seminar area and the restaurant bar, where I balanced functionality with a sense of elegance and warmth.
The result is a harmonious blend of modern comfort and regional authenticity, where natural materials, soft textures, and curated lighting create a serene and refined ambiance for visitors.
